Part of the region is under an Air Quality Alert today. This means ozone levels may approach or exceed unhealthy standards, according to Ritz.

To reduce ozone levels, you can do the following:

  • Carpool
  • Refuel your vehicle
  • Do not idle your vehicle
  • Mow your lawn during the evening hours and avoid using gas-powered lawn equipment.
